| Element | Description |
| Project Name | Yantai Wanda Plaza |
| Project Location | Yantai City, Shandong Province (Core Commercial District) |
| Total Curtain Wall Area | 14,000 square meters |
| Client Positioning | A city core commercial complex integrating shopping, dining, and entertainment, aiming for maximum public traffic aggregation. |
| Core Challenge | Energy consumption pressure from large glass facades. Commercial complexes require extensive glass for display and attraction, but significant solar heat gain and heat loss result in high operating costs. |
| Project Goal | To construct a modern commercial landmark with visual appeal, high energy efficiency, and high safety, ensuring long-term low-cost operation. |
To address the conflicting demands of illumination, display, and energy control in a commercial building, we provided a customized high-performance glass solution covering all 14,000 square meters of the project's facade.
Configuration Details: Utilized the 6Low-E + 12a + 6 Double-Tempered IGU (Insulated Glass Unit).
Low-E Coating: Applied high-performance Low-E coating to efficiently block summer solar heat gain (reducing SHGC) while optimizing Visible Light Transmittance (VLT) to ensure indoor display effectiveness and natural lighting.
Double-Tempered Structure: Both inner and outer panes were tempered, greatly enhancing the facade's impact safety and wind load resistance, which is crucial for high-traffic commercial landmarks.
Precision Energy Control: Through this high-performance configuration, the building's Thermal Transmittance (U-Value) was effectively controlled, significantly reducing the commercial complex's largest operational cost—HVAC energy consumption.
Comprehensive Safety Enhancement: The double-tempered structure ensures the extreme safety of the glass facade, meeting the high safety standards required by high-traffic commercial centers.
